Atomic physics at storage rings: recent results from the ESR and future perspectives at FAIR

Description
At the Gesellschaft fuer Schwerionenforschung mbH (GSI), atomic physics research focusses on spectroscopy of simple atomic systems at high-Z, where both the structure as well as the dynamics are determined by extreme electromagnetic fields. The Experimental Storage Ring (ESR) enables us to store these ions for long periods of time, under ideal circumstances, and to perform high-precision experiments. By means of advanced laser, target, and detector technology, we are able to address the still largely unexplored physics of these simple but exotic systems. In this paper we present some important aspects of the current and future atomic physics program, and show recent results from the ESR. (author)
